The EPYC 9555 is manufactured by AMD. It was released in 10 October 2024 (1 year ago). It is based on the Turin (2024) architecture. It features 64 cores and 128 threads. Base frequency is 3.2 GHz, with boost up to 4.4 GHz. L3 cache: 256 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: SP5. Thermal design power (TDP): 360 Watt. Memory support: DDR5. Passmark benchmark score: 133,253 points. Launch price was $9,826.

The EPYC 9655 is manufactured by AMD. It was released in 10 October 2024 (1 year ago). It is based on the Turin (2024) architecture. It features 96 cores and 192 threads. Base frequency is 2.6 GHz, with boost up to 4.5 GHz. L3 cache: 384 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: SP5. Thermal design power (TDP): 400 Watt. Memory support: DDR5. Passmark benchmark score: 156,110 points. Launch price was $11,852.

Processing Power

The EPYC 9555 packs 64 cores / 128 threads, while the EPYC 9655 offers 96 cores / 192 threads — the EPYC 9655 has 32 more cores. Boost clocks reach 4.4 GHz on the EPYC 9555 versus 4.5 GHz on the EPYC 9655 — a 2.2% clock advantage for the EPYC 9655 (base: 3.2 GHz vs 2.6 GHz). Both are built on the Turin (2024) architecture using a 4 nm process. In PassMark, the EPYC 9555 scores 133,253 against the EPYC 9655's 156,110 — a 15.8% lead for the EPYC 9655. L3 cache: 256 MB (total) on the EPYC 9555 vs 384 MB (total) on the EPYC 9655.

Memory & Platform

Both processors use the SP5 socket with PCIe 5.0. Both support up to DDR5-6000 memory speed. The EPYC 9655 supports up to 9 TB of RAM compared to 6 TB 50% more capacity for professional workloads. Both feature 12-channel memory with ECC support. Both provide 128 PCIe lanes. Chipset compatibility: SP5 (EPYC 9555) and SP5 (EPYC 9655).

Advanced Features

Both support AMD-V, SEV-SNP virtualization. Primary use case: EPYC 9555 targets Data Center, EPYC 9655 targets Data Center. Direct competitor: EPYC 9555 rivals Xeon 6972P; EPYC 9655 rivals Xeon 6979P.
